About this item
- FASTEST, MOST POWERFUL XBOX — Experience next‑generation performance with 12 teraflops of processing power, delivering smoother gameplay, richer worlds, and faster responsiveness than any previous Xbox.
- TRUE 4K GAMING UP TO 120 FPS — Enjoy breathtaking visuals with true 4K resolution, HDR, and frame rates up to 120 FPS, plus support for advanced effects like hardware‑accelerated ray tracing.
- 1TB CUSTOM SSD & VELOCITY ARCHITECTURE — Reduce load times dramatically with the custom 1TB SSD and Xbox Velocity Architecture, enabling lightning‑fast performance and seamless world streaming.
- QUICK RESUME MULTITASKING — Instantly switch between multiple games and resume exactly where you left off, powered by next‑gen memory and storage technology.
- FOUR‑GENERATION BACKWARD COMPATIBILITY — Play thousands of games from Xbox Series X|S, Xbox One, Xbox 360, and Original Xbox, with many titles enhanced for better visuals and performance.
- INCLUDES WIRELESS CONTROLLER — Comes with an Xbox Wireless Controller featuring textured grips, improved ergonomics, and precise input for competitive and casual play.
- PLAY MORE WITH GAME PASS ULTIMATE — Access hundreds of high‑quality console games, play new titles day one, enjoy online multiplayer, and stream games with cloud gaming. Membership sold separately.
- WHAT’S IN THE BOX — Includes the Xbox Series X console, one Xbox Wireless Controller, an ultra‑high‑speed HDMI cable, power cable, and two AA batteries to get you gaming right away.

- Reviewed in the United States on December 30, 2024Platform: Xbox Series XEdition: 1TB Disc Drive Edition + ControllerVerified PurchaseAfter playing my old Xbox One heavily since it came out I figured it was finally time to make the switch to new gen. Immediately I recognized the loading times for every game were significantly improved. And I do mean significantly. This is the biggest draw of the new console (for me), as it makes finding matches, fast traveling, and switching between games lightning quick just to name a few. Furthermore, every other technical aspect is improved in some way from old gen, which is to be expected of course. Graphics are even more beautiful and the higher FPS (frames per second) means you'll even have a competitive advantage against players who are still on old gen consoles.
I do have a small bone to pick though- the name for the console is disappointing. I feel as though they could've come up with something far better than the "Series X". It's just unnecessarily confusing and I cringe a little when I think that there's likely some folks that're new to gaming that frustratedly get a PlayStation instead because they can't tell which Xbox is the new one due to the convoluted naming scheme. PlayStation had it right: 1>2>3>4>5. Simple right? But Xbox..: Xbox>360>One>Series X. Like come on. Not to mention when you consider the alternate versions like the Series S or XS or whatever they're called. Please do better next time Microsoft.
Well anyways, the price has now dropped considerably since the Series X was first released. I held off on buying one for a while due to a deficit of actual next-gen games to play (scalpers hoarding the consoles didn't help either). Luckily there has been a respectable amount of next-gen games released since then so you can actually enjoy the console to its full potential with many different titles.
Elden Ring in particular is absolutely breathtaking! Of course there are many other gorgeous games that pair well with the Series X, but that one in particular really stuck with me. Some locations in that game are like masterpiece paintings that you can actually roam around in.
Video games sure have come a long way. I'm excited for the future of them, and the Series X has stoked this hearth of passion further. So if the time you spend enjoying games is worth anything to you, then this console will be as well.

- Reviewed in the United States on January 9, 2026Platform: Xbox Series XEdition: 1TB Disc Drive Edition + ControllerVerified PurchaseWe finally decided to upgrade, and I’m honestly impressed by how much faster this is compared to our old console. The best part for me is the quick resume feature. I don't have a ton of free time, so being able to switch games or jump right back in without sitting through long loading screens is a game changer.
It is definitely a big piece of hardware, kind of looks like a small tower, but the matte finish is sleek and blends in pretty well with our entertainment center (black theme). The controller feels really comfortable in my hands, with a nice grip on the back that doesn't feel slippery. Everything just looks crisp and runs super smooth, which makes the little bit of gaming time I get actually feel relaxing.
